
US-Iran War: The Congress on Sunday said the government’s response to the war with Iran was a betrayal of India’s values, principles and interests, saying the nation was paying a heavy price for both the substance and style of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s foreign policy.
Taking a dig at PM Modi, Congress general secretary in charge of communications Jairam Ramesh said India’s foreign policy under the “self-proclaimed Vishwaguru” is being brutally exposed, despite the PM’s cheerleaders leading him.

“Modi visited Israel on February 25-26, 2026, at a time when the whole world was aware that US-Israeli military attack on Iran that regime change was imminent. The attack began just two days after Mr. Modi left Israel, where his Knesset speech was a display of shameful moral cowardice,” Ramesh said on X.
“The Modi government’s response to the war with Iran, which included targeted assassinations, was a betrayal of India’s values, principles, interests and concerns,” he said.
Ramesh’s remarks come in Iranian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ei he was killed in a major attack by Israel and the United States. State media said an 86-year-old man was killed in an airstrike on his compound in central Tehran.

Congress leader Priyanka Gandhi Vadra also condemned the “targeted assassination” of the leadership of a sovereign nation, Iran, by the so-called leaders of the democratic world.
“The killing of so many innocent people is despicable and deserves strong condemnation, regardless of the claimed reason. It is tragic that several nations have now been drawn into the conflict,” Vadra said in a post on X.
The world needs peace, not more unnecessary wars. Those in charge would do well to remember the words of Mahatma Gandhi: An eye for an eye makes the whole world blind,” she said.

“I hope that after bowing before the Prime Minister of Israel and President Trump, our Prime Minister will make every effort to bring all Indian citizens in the affected countries back home to safety,” Vadra wrote.
Congress on Saturday condemned the attacks on Iran by the US and Israel and called on the Indian government to help end hostilities and ensure the security of all Indians in the Middle East.
The opposition party expressed concern over the escalating hostilities in the region and urged the government to ensure that all Indians living there are safe.
The United States and Israel launched a major attack on Iran on Saturday, with Trump calling on the Iranian public to take control of their destiny and rise up against the Islamic leadership that has ruled their country since 1979.

AAP Rajya Sabha MP Sanjay Singh wondered why PM Modi did not post on X over Khamenei killing. Singh recalled how the prime minister declared a day of national mourning following the death of Iranian President Ebrahim Raisi, who was killed along with seven other people when the helicopter they were traveling in crashed near the border with Azerbaijan in May 2024.
“Modi ji what happened today? You declared national mourning for the death of the Iranian president. You don’t even muster up the courage to tweet a single condolence for the death of Iran Supreme Leader Khameneibecause it’s America’s fault. The country does not need such a cowardly prime minister who is Trump’s puppet,” Singh said in the post.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i will chair a high-level meeting tonight to assess the impact on India. Conflict in West Asia: PM Modi to chair Cabinet Committee on Security tonight
Modi will chair the Cabinet Committee on Security meeting around 10 pm today after returning from Puducherry, news agency ANI reported citing sources.
